According to a report from Coinworld, on June 20 (UTC+8), the Norwegian government announced plans to implement a temporary ban on the construction of new data centers for crypto mining that use high-energy-consuming technologies, aiming to prioritize the allocation of power resources to other critical industries. This measure is expected to take effect in the fall of 2025. Minister of Digitalization and Administration Karianne Tung stated that the government will "restrict crypto mining activities as much as possible" due to its "extremely high power consumption, which brings almost no significant employment or income to the local economy."
